Understanding Collision Repair Audits: A Comprehensive Overview

Collision repair audits are a critical process ensuring vehicle repair services maintain impeccable standards. These audits, specifically focused on paint matching and color consistency, play a pivotal role in upholding the quality and value of collision damage repairs. When a vehicle undergoes collision repair, achieving precise paint matching is not merely about aesthetics; it guarantees structural integrity while restoring the car’s pre-accident appearance. The audit process involves meticulous assessments, utilizing advanced tools and expert knowledge to match colors across vast automotive paint systems.
A comprehensive collision repair audit begins with a detailed inspection of the damaged areas. Professionals carefully document existing color codes, identify unique identifiers on paints, and employ specialized equipment for precise measurements. This data is then compared against original manufacturer specifications and historical records to ensure exact replication. For instance, modern cars often feature sophisticated paint systems with multiple layers and clear coats, demanding meticulous attention during audits. A minor discrepancy in shade or texture can impact the overall finish, leading to customer dissatisfaction.

Paint Matching Techniques: Ensuring Color Consistency During Repairs

In collision repair audits focusing on paint matching and color consistency, mastering techniques for ensuring precise color replication is paramount. Auto repair services that specialize in automotive restoration understand that every car has a unique color profile, influenced by factors like manufacturing variations, weathering, and past repairs. To maintain originality and customer satisfaction, technicians must employ advanced paint matching methods that transcend basic color codes.
One effective technique involves utilizing advanced spectrophotometers to measure and compare the precise color properties of damaged areas with those of the vehicle’s original finish. This scientific approach ensures minute detail in color consistency, going beyond simple visual inspection. For instance, a study by the International Automotive Color Association (IACA) found that spectrophotometric analysis can achieve color matching accuracy within 0.5 DEI (Delta E), a level imperceptible to the human eye.
Additionally, cross-referencing with original equipment manufacturer (OEM) specifications and utilizing industry-standard paint databases enhances the precision of paint matching. These resources provide detailed formulations and application guidelines, ensuring that auto body repair services replicate not just the color but also the finish quality of the original car paint services. Continuous training on emerging technologies and paint systems keeps technicians adept at navigating these sophisticated methods, ultimately delivering top-tier automotive restoration.
Best Practices for Effective Post-Audit Implementation

Collision repair audits are a critical component of ensuring high-quality vehicle restoration, particularly when it comes to paint matching and color consistency across various collision repair processes such as vehicle dent repair and frame straightening. A well-conducted post-audit implementation is key to maximizing the benefits of these audits. Herein lie the best practices that repair shops should adopt to effectively leverage audit findings for continuous improvement in car paint repair services.
First, establish a clear action plan based on the audit results. This involves meticulously documenting all discrepancies identified during the collision repair audit and categorizing them according to severity and recurring patterns. For instance, data may reveal consistent issues with specific color codes or particular techniques used in frame straightening. Prioritize addressing these problems to ensure that subsequent audits show measurable improvements. Implementing targeted training programs for staff involved in vehicle dent repair and car paint applications can significantly mitigate recurring errors.
Secondly, maintain detailed records of all audit findings, actions taken, and their outcomes. A robust record-keeping system allows for trend analysis over time, enabling shop managers to make data-driven decisions. For example, tracking the implementation of new color matching techniques in collision repair could reveal a 15% reduction in repaint jobs requiring re-auditing within six months. Such data underscores the importance of consistent adherence to best practices and encourages continuous refinement of audit protocols.
Lastly, foster an open feedback loop where all stakeholders—from shop managers to technicians—are encouraged to contribute insights. Regular team meetings dedicated to discussing audit findings can facilitate knowledge sharing and promote a culture of continuous learning. This collaborative approach ensures that lessons learned from collision repair audits are not confined to isolated departments but are integrated into the day-to-day operations of the entire workshop, enhancing overall quality control in vehicle dent repair and frame straightening services.
